It was supposed to be a forgone conclusion. The Miami Heat, reigning NBA champions, had blown everybody away in the regular season, racking up a ridiculous 27-game winning streak – the longest in over 30 years.
LeBron James had only further cemented his position as the best player on the planet – winning his fourth MVP award in five seasons, one vote off becoming the first unanimous winner in history. In the end, however, NBA history was decided with a little bit of magic from Ray Allen.
